- What is Enova International's change in fair value?
- Enova International (ENVA) reported change in fair value of $346.18M in Q1 2026.
- How has Enova International's change in fair value changed year-over-year?
- Enova International's change in fair value increased by 8.4% year-over-year, from $319.36M to $346.18M.
- What is the long-term trend for Enova International's change in fair value?
- Over 4 years (2021 to 2025), Enova International's change in fair value has grown at a 63.8% compound annual growth rate (CAGR), from $183.67M to $1.32B.
- What does change in fair value mean?
- This metric represents the periodic adjustment to the carrying value of financial assets or liabilities measured at fair value through the income statement. It reflects unrealized gains or losses resulting from changes in market conditions, credit risk, or valuation models applied to the company's loan portfolios or financial instruments. Monitoring this figure is essential for understanding the volatility of the company's balance sheet and the underlying credit quality of its lending products.
